Home-made Applesauce

In the spirit of the New Year it was out with the old and in with the new in my kitchen this afternoon. The old - a couple of apples that have taken up residency in the fruit bowl this week. The new - homemade applesauce to take to work for lunch this week.

Super simple to make, simply peel the apples (bonus if you can keep the skin in one long peel), slice them up, add a squirt of lemon juice (or vitamin C to prevent browning) and boil until soft. Mash with a fork, cool and store in the refrigerator.
